Can I take folic acid when my period comes?

Young people nowadays are very planned when they want to have children, and usually need a long time to prepare for pregnancy. Generally speaking, folic acid is needed during the preparation period for pregnancy. Folic acid can reduce the occurrence of fetal deformities and is also good for health. However, some people get their period during the preparation period for pregnancy. Some people worry that taking folic acid during menstruation will be harmful to the body, while some people think that taking folic acid causes their period.

Can I take folic acid when my period comes?

Folic acid is a type of vitamin B. This nutrient is also found in our daily diet. Therefore, during the menstrual period, women who are planning to become pregnant can take folic acid for pregnant women as usual to maintain the folic acid level in their bodies. In addition, some people suspect that folic acid will affect menstruation and cause menstrual irregularities, but this has not been confirmed by research. Usually women who take folic acid have entered the stage of preparing for pregnancy and will give themselves certain psychological expectations and hints, and psychological effects have a great impact on the menstrual period.

How much folic acid should I take every day during pregnancy preparation?

1. Folic acid is one of the vitamin B complex, which is equivalent to pteroylglutamate extracted and purified from spinach leaves. It is the same substance as vitamin M. Folic acid promotes the maturation of young cells in the bone marrow. A lack of folic acid will lead to an increase in abnormal immature red blood cells, anemia, and a decrease in white blood cells.

2. The development of the fetus's nervous system is complete during pregnancy. During the third to fourth week of pregnancy, the neural tube of the embryo should have closed. If it is not completely closed, it is a neural tube defect, which manifests as central nervous system malformations such as spina bifida, encephalocele, and anencephaly. Therefore, women should supplement folic acid during the pregnancy preparation stage to prepare a good pregnancy environment.

3. The best time to supplement folic acid is from 3 months before you plan to become pregnant to the entire pregnancy period. In the second and third trimesters, the synthesis of fetal DNA, the increase of placenta, maternal tissue and red blood cells will greatly increase the pregnant woman's need for folic acid. Therefore, even if the fetal nervous system has been fully developed in the early stages of pregnancy, folic acid deficiency in the middle and late stages of pregnancy can still cause megaloblastic anemia, preeclampsia, and placental abruption.
